最佳答案
总线带宽是衡量计算机内部数据传输效率的重要指标。本文将详细解释如何计算总线的带宽公式,并探讨影响总线带宽的各个因素。
首先,总线带宽的计算公式可以总结为:带宽 = 数据宽度 / 传输时间。其中,数据宽度指的是总线一次能够传输的数据位数,而传输时间则包括总线时钟周期和每次传输所需的总线时钟周期数。
详细来说,如果总线的数据宽度为W(例如,32位、64位等),总线时钟频率为f(单位Hz),每次传输需要n个时钟周期,那么带宽的计算公式可以展开为: 带宽 = W / (n * 1/f) = W * f / n(单位:bps,即每秒位数)。
在这个公式中,有三个关键因素影响总线带宽:
- 数据宽度W:数据宽度越大,每次可以传输更多的数据位,带宽自然越高。
- 总线时钟频率f:频率越高,单位时间内可以进行更多次的数据传输,从而提高带宽。
- 每次传输所需的时钟周期数n:n的值越小,数据传输的效率越高,带宽也随之增加。
举例来说,一个64位宽(W=64),时钟频率为1GHz(f=1,000,000,000Hz),每次传输只需要1个时钟周期(n=1)的总线,其带宽计算如下: 带宽 = 64 * 1,000,000,000 / 1 = 64,000,000,000 bps,或者64 Gbps。
最后,总结一下,计算总线带宽的公式让我们能够量化地了解总线的性能。通过提高数据宽度、时钟频率或减少传输所需的时钟周期数,可以有效提升总线的带宽,从而提高计算机的整体性能。